摘 要:本文介绍了一种新的脑电信号有线传输技术 :经公共电话网络、通过一个调频信道、利用时分多路复用方式可同步传输多达 2 0导联的脑电信号 ;通过另一个调频信道 ,接收方还能实时获知受测试者的当前意识状态以及实现收发双方的同步。经在此基础上开发的脑电遥测系统的使用验证 :该技术能涵盖大部分临床诊断的实际需要、并且信号的传输质量较好、失真度小、无明显噪声污染、无基漂。A kind of EEG(electroencephalogram) tele transmission technology is introduced in this paper, up to 20 leads of signals can be transmitted synchronously using TDM technology in one FM channel through public telephone networks; on the other hand, current potential evocation method and commands of synchronization between transmitter and receiver are also transmitted through the other FM channel simultaneously. The EEG telemetry system, which is developed on the basis of this transmission technology, has shown that this cable transmission technology can satisfy almost all clinic needs. The quality of tele transmission is nearly perfect, and distortion of signals, noise pollution and shift of base lines nearly do not exist.
